And so, what actually is a stair lift? A stair lift is an useful tool that can assist you to be mobile as well as it brings you down and up the stairs, allowing you to move around in your place easily and do things that you would most likely be unable to undertake normally.

A stair lift is practically a mechanical seat that assists to raise you down and up the stairs. A track or rail is typically placed to the stair treads and a seat or perhaps a lifting system is connected to the track. In Cowley County, you can easily get on the chair or the platform as well as the chair glides along the track allowing you move up and also down the stairs. You additionally have styles where you can use your wheelchair on the stair lift and these are referred to as platform lifts.

Safety and Comfort

A stair lift provides automated passage up and down the staircases. The seat of the stair lift has a lap belt that ensures that you are safe when the stair lift is in motion. Today, a lot of stair lifts have inbuilt protection functions that are going to prevent its use in the event it experiences an obstruction on the staircases or even if any type of portion of the stair lift i.e. the seat, armrests or footrest is not in its appropriate setting. The stair lifts in addition are equipped alongside a protection fixture that stops any unintentional usage or kids from using the chair.

Typically, the chair of the stair lift has a changeable and also padded seating and armrests that offer best support. You can additionally change the footrest depending on to your height.

Staircase Accessibility

A lot of stair lifts come with quite slim profiles and do not block the whole staircase, which is openly reachable. Typically, the chair, in addition to the footrest are foldable to ensure it is not an obstruction for family members and other individuals needing to use the staircases.

Usability

Stair Lifts are extremely easy to use as well as manage. Most stair lifts have a button situated on the armrest of the chair that allows you to manage it. These days, lots of stair lift versions are supplied with a remote control that allows you to control it really simply and also moves the stair lift to the top or the bottom of the staircases as needed. When the stair lift is in the park setting, it recharges, in order that you can easily make use of it whenever you need to and also just in case there is a electricity outage, the stair lift usually has an built-in battery back-up that enables you to handle it.

Different Types Of Stair Lifts

There are different kinds of stair lifts like:

Stair Lifts for Straight Stairs​

If your residence features a straight staircase, then a stair lift which manages on a straight trackway or rail is usually one of the most typical kind of stair lift. These also provide drop-down or fixed seats that are simply connected. The installment of a stair lift for a straight stairs can come to be a problem if the stairs are too tight. If your stairs is primarily straight yet it comes with an arc on top, then you may select a straight stair lift and a connecting system that serves to help the lift to come to the landing better. Usually, straight stair lifts are the least costly as well as simplest to set up.

Stair Lifts for Curved Stairs​

In the event that your staircases are actually curved, then you must attach a curved stair lift. These are actually a lot more complex compared to straight stair lifts and they require curved tracks to accommodate the precise shape of the staircase. Normally, curved stair lifts are even more expensive.

Wheelchair and Platform Stair Lifts​

Wheelchair inclined platform wheelchair lift or "IPL" Is a lift that is connected to your stairs. It moves wheelchairs back and forth the stairs instead of a separate machine like an elevator or a vertical stairlift. Some platforms might fold up facing the wall, while others remain fixed. Options depend on your needs and your home. Many inclined platform lifts feature the choice for a remote to call for the platform to the landing area/position of their preference. Inclined platform lifts require adequate headroom, stairs width, and landing room at the base of the stairs. Incline wheelchair lifts are an ideal choice for those who do not wish to transfer off and on their wheelchair in order to go up and down the stairs. It is an effective solution to increase accessibility around stairs. This is an ideal choice for individuals that do not have the area for or the resources for an elevator or a vertical platform lift in their home. Allows an individual in a wheelchair to get up and descend stairs without needing to transfer from wheelchair or scooter Uses a platform that rides backwards and forwards the staircases For both interior as well as exterior Folds up away when not in use Has safety stop sensors & battery back-up Both are reliable and secure for wheelchairs and individuals.

Outdoor Or Exterior Stair Lifts​

These kinds of stair lifts are commonly put in outside on stairways that go to your front door or on steps going to your back yard or even patio. Exterior stair lifts are essentially similar to straight or curved stair lifts that are used indoors; however, these are normally made with weather-proof components.

Standing Stair Lifts​

If your staircase is especially very slender and it will not accommodate a seated stair lift, then a standing stair lift is recommended. However, you must ensure that you have sufficient headroom in the staircase ,as well,that it is high enough to accommodate you when you are standing. Standing stair lifts are primarily beneficial for persons experiencing challenges flexing their knees. Some standing stair lift designs also feature a short ledge that enables you to retain your balance. Even so, standing stair lift may not be suitable for everyone, particularly if you don't have the sturdiness to stand for a few minutes or you are simply susceptible to getting dizzy.

1. What is a stair lift?

A stair lift is a motorized chair that moves along a rail mounted to the treads of the stairs. It helps individuals with mobility issues to travel up and down stairs safely and comfortably.

2. Who can benefit from a stair lift?

Stair lifts are beneficial for individuals with limited mobility, such as seniors, people with disabilities, or those recovering from surgery or an injury.

3. How much does a stair lift cost?

The cost of a stair lift can vary widely depending on the model, features, and whether it is for a straight or curved staircase. Generally, prices range from $2,000 to $15,000.

4. Can a stair lift be installed on any type of staircase?

Stair lifts can be installed on most types of staircases, including straight, curved, and even outdoor stairs. Custom configurations are available for more complex staircases.

5. How long does it take to install a stair lift?

Installation time can vary, but a standard straight stair lift can typically be installed in a few hours. Curved stair lifts, which require custom rails, may take longer.

6. Are stair lifts safe to use?

Yes, stair lifts are designed with safety features such as seat belts, swivel seats, footrest sensors, and emergency stop buttons to ensure safe operation.

7. What happens if there is a power outage?

Most stair lifts are equipped with battery backups that allow them to operate during a power outage. The battery will need to be recharged once power is restored.

8. How do I maintain a stair lift?

Regular maintenance is important to keep a stair lift in good working condition. This includes cleaning the rail, checking for loose bolts, and scheduling annual professional inspections.

9. Can stair lifts be rented or leased?

Yes, many companies offer rental or lease options for stair lifts, which can be a cost-effective solution for short-term needs.
